在当今信息时代,科学上网成为了很多人关注的话题。尤其是对于使用Linux系统的用户而言,掌握如何有效进行科学上网是至关重要的。本文将全面介绍在Linux系统中实现科学上网的各种方法,包括但不限于VPN和代理服务器的配置与使用。希望能够帮助大家在日常使用中畅享互联网的自由。
什么是科学上网?
科学上网是指使用各种网络工具和技术绕过网络限制,访问被屏蔽的网站和资源。这对信息获取、学习和工作都至关重要。
Linux系统科学上网的重要性
- 隐私保护:许多用户在网上浏览时希望保护自己的隐私,使用科学上网工具可以隐藏用户的真实IP地址。
- 绕过限制:在某些情况下,访问特定网站可能受到限制,科学上网允许用户轻松绕过这些限制。
- 获取信息:许多重要的信息和资源在特定的国家受到限制,通过科学上网可以获取全球的信息。
科学上网的主要方法
1. 使用VPN
VPN(虚拟私人网络)是实现科学上网的最常用方法之一。通过建立加密的隧道,VPN可以有效保护用户的在线活动。
VPN的配置步骤
-
选择合适的VPN服务
- 选择一个支持Linux系统的VPN服务。
-
安装VPN客户端
- 通过终端使用命令进行安装。例如,使用
apt
安装OpenVPN: bash sudo apt install openvpn
- 通过终端使用命令进行安装。例如,使用
-
获取VPN配置文件
- 从VPN服务商下载相应的配置文件。
-
连接VPN
- 使用以下命令连接到VPN: bash sudo openvpn –config your_config_file.ovpn
2. 使用代理
代理服务器也是一种常见的科学上网方法,能够通过中转服务器访问被限制的网站。
代理的配置步骤
-
选择合适的代理服务
- 可以选择HTTP、SOCKS5等不同类型的代理。
-
安装代理客户端
- 例如,可以使用
proxychains
: bash sudo apt install proxychains
- 例如,可以使用
-
配置代理
- 在
/etc/proxychains.conf
中添加代理服务器信息。
- 在
-
使用代理
- 使用proxychains命令来运行需要代理的程序: bash proxychains your_program
常见的Linux科学上网工具
- Shadowsocks:一种轻量级的代理工具,支持多种平台。
- V2Ray:功能强大的网络协议,可以实现非常灵活的网络配置。
- Tor:专注于匿名性,可以安全地访问被封锁的网站。
Linux下科学上网的最佳实践
- 频繁更换节点:避免使用固定的节点,增加隐私保护。
- 定期检查IP泄露:确保在使用科学上网时不会不小心泄露真实IP。
- 选择安全协议:VPN时选择较为安全的协议,例如OpenVPN或IKEv2。
FAQ(常见问题解答)
1. 如何选择适合我的VPN?
选择VPN时要考虑以下几个因素:
- 速度和稳定性:选择响应快的VPN,避免因为速度慢而影响使用体验。
- 隐私政策:确保所选VPN不记录用户活动日志,保护用户隐私。
- 兼容性:检查VPN是否支持Linux系统。
2. 使用VPN会降低网速吗?
在某些情况下,使用VPN可能会导致网速下降,但良好的VPN服务提供商会尽量减少这种影响,用户可以通过选择快速的服务节点来优化速度。
3. 可以同时使用多种科学上网工具吗?
可以,但需注意可能会导致网络配置复杂,建议逐一测试每个工具的功能和效果。
4. 如何确保安全上网?
- 定期检查设备的安全设置,保持系统更新。
- 使用复合类型的安全工具,如防火墙和反病毒软件。
- 若通过公共Wi-Fi上网,一定要使用VPN工具,以保护您的数据安全。
结论
掌握在Linux系统中科学上网的技巧将大大提升您的网络体验,无论是获取信息还是保护隐私。通过VPN、代理和其他工具,用户可以轻松地实现无障碍的上网体验。希望本文能为您提供实用的参考和帮助!
正文完